One notable example is (2007), a 2D demake that recreated the Mario Kart 64 experience in a top-down style using the Lua scripting language. It featured 5 playable characters (including Link), power-ups like shells and bananas, and 4 AI opponents.

: A standalone homebrew game built using the Lua language specifically for the PSP. It is not an emulation of the N64 original but a recreation that includes multiple tracks and playable characters like Mario and Luigi.
